Catalog description

Feminist Theory (3-0) Traces evolving definitions of feminism through history, as theorists seek to understand the causes of gender inequality and women's diverse identities and oppressions. In addition to examining the impact of feminist theory across academic disciplines, the course also explores the political and practical applications of contemporary feminist thought. Prerequisite: WS 2300 with a grade of "C" or better. WS 2300 may be taken concurrently with WS 4310 .
